In its stock form, the Rochester Quadrajet carburetor often gets a bad rap The long-discontinued Rochester Quadrajet carburetor remains popular with performance rebuilders and tuners. The Rochester Quadrajet carburetor was introduced in 1965, and its production run lasted until 1990. Like actor Rodney Dangerfield, this carburetor got no respect, earning derogatory nicknames from some including “Quadrajunk” or “Quadrabog”.
